Antonio Carracci (1583-1618), entourage of Christ in the tomb, 1609 Oil on canvas H_79.5 cm W_99.5 cm Faded, restoration report 2005 Bears a date of 1609. This Entombment impresses with its bold colors and dynamic composition. While the drawing seems similar to the compositions of Sisto Badalocchio (1581/1585-1647), notably the Entombment circa 1610 in the Borghese Gallery, the color and modeling are clearly influenced by the Carracci, particularly Antonio. Son of Agostino Carrache, Antonio was probably raised with Badalocchio and began his apprenticeship with his father. When Badalocchio died in 1602, he moved to Uncle Annibale's workshop in Rome. Around 1609, he inherited the family workshop and worked alongside Guido Reni on several major projects, including the Annunciation Chapel in the Quirinal Palace. Expert: Cabinet Artéon
